#9cd296 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#9cd296 is composed of 61.2% red, 82.4% green and 58.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 25.7% cyan, 0% magenta, 28.6% yellow and 17.6% black. It has a hue angle of 114 degrees, a saturation of 40% and a lightness of 70.6%. #9cd296 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#39a52d. Closest websafe color is: #99cc99.

● #9cd296 color description : Slightly desaturated lime green.
#9cd296 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#9cd296 has RGB values of R:156, G:210, B:150 and CMYK values of C:0.26, M:0, Y:0.29, K:0.18. Its decimal value is 10277526.
